[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]I have a child in 2nd and in pre-K 4 at Calle Ocho, the oldest started there in Prek-3 so it is our 5th year at the school. Overall our experience has been extremely positive. Yes, the first year or so back after covid was bumpy but that was pretty universally true. This year has been incredibly smooth including the transition from the old ED to the interim ED to the new ED. FWIW- the new ED has two kids at C8 so she has a lot of skin in the game. My kids have thrived in the immersion experience and have had skilled and dedicated teachers. They love going to school each day. Is that everyone's experience? Of course not. Every family is bringing their own needs and expectations to the table and no school is perfect for every family. We do not have experience with IEP's etc. so I cannot speak to that. [/quote] +1. We have been at CO for 6 years and have had similar great experience. Post covid was bumpy. Staff and teachers are great and really dedicated. [/quote]
